THE LEADING BY THE SPIRIT BEING FOR LIVING

In the last message we pointed out that the matter of the leading by the Spirit is not mainly for certain matters, for business, for activities, or even for actions. It is altogether for a living of a life with God and for God and before God. We Christians should firstly pay our full attention to our living. This means to our being, to what we are. As believers who are in Christ, we must firstly pay our full attention to what we are. Our activities and actions are secondary. As long as your being is right, your activities will also be right. In other words, as long as your living is under the leading by the Spirit, then whatever you do as a kind of activity would spontaneously and simultaneously also be under the leading by the Spirit.

If you are a person living a life absolutely under the leading by the Spirit, where you go to school will also be under the leading by the Spirit. But if you are not a person living under the leading by the Spirit of life, it would be hard for you to decide where God wants you to study. It would be hard for you to get clear about God’s leading. The leading you receive at that time may not be so accurate. You should not pay so much attention to your activities, to what school you should attend, to what job you have to take, to what house you have to rent or to buy. As long as you pay your full attention to your living and live a life daily, moment by moment, under the leading by the Spirit you will be clear. This is basic.

If you are right with such a living under the leading by the Spirit, whatever you say is under the leading by the Spirit. Wherever you go, that is the leading by the Spirit. And whatever you do is under the leading by the Spirit because your entire living is under the leading by the Spirit. If you laugh, that is under the leading by the Spirit. If you weep, that is under the leading by the Spirit. Even when you are angry, it is under the leading by the Spirit. You might ask how we could be angry under the leading by the Spirit. But the Lord Jesus became angry at least two or three times (John 2:14-16; Matt. 23:13-36; Mark 3:1-5). And He was angry under the leading by the Spirit.

A LIVING AS A TESTIMONY OF JESUS

Again I say, the leading by the Spirit is not a matter, strictly speaking, for activities. It is a matter for our daily living. What God wants of us is not a certain kind of business done by us. It is not a certain kind of work accomplished by us. No! what God wants of us is a life, that is, a living as a testimony of Jesus. We have to live a life that is a testimony of Jesus. In other words, we live a life that expresses Christ. Such a life that lives Christ is surely under the leading by the Spirit. So the New Testament says to walk according to the spirit (Rom. 8:4). To walk according to the spirit is just to live under the leading by the Spirit. In Greek the word walk means to live, to walk, even to have our being. We should walk and live and have our being according to the spirit. This is to be under the leading by the Spirit. As long as we walk this way, and we live such a life under the leading by the Spirit, whatever we do will be also under the leading. Whatever we say will be under the leading.

THE DAILY LIVING

All of these twenty-two items do not refer to an activity or to a business. They refer to the daily living or to the daily life. The law of sin and of death is not related to a business or an activity. It is related to your being. It is related to your daily walk and your daily life. Sin also is a matter in life; it is not a matter in business. You may consider that many people sin in business, but you have to realize that they sin in business because they are sinful in their living. If they were not sinful in their living, they would never sin in business. To sin in business is not the root or the basic problem. The basic problem, the root for sinning in business, is the daily life and the daily living. If you are just a sinful person, living in a sinful way, when you do business you will surely sin.

Death also is a matter of living. You do not live a life full of life; you live a life full of death. Your daily living is a constitution of death. Death here in Romans 8 is not related to activity, business, school, and so forth. Strictly speaking, it is related to your daily living.

Flesh also refers to your being. You are just a fallen person. You are just a person abominable in the eyes of God. You are a person reprobate before God because you are so fleshly. You even become flesh. This is your living, your being. A person does business in the flesh because he lives in the flesh. If he lived in the spirit, could he do business in the flesh? It is impossible! Whether a professor teaches in the flesh or in the spirit depends upon where he lives. If he lives in the flesh, he will be a professor in the flesh. If he lives in the spirit, he will be a professor in the spirit. So the problem always is not with what you do. It is always wrapped up with what you are, with your being, with your living.
